Output 3580ed1a684dab3671753736301058be9a876cf302df70157c105e758bd79a4c:2

value
514344
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 32306151b8f07860dedde8e614cdc37ce2d9fe15b6908e8f82901c1d153c73a0
address
tb1pxgcxz5dc7puxphkaarnpfnwr0n3dnls4k6ggaruzjqwp69fuwwsqtapdmh
transaction
3580ed1a684dab3671753736301058be9a876cf302df70157c105e758bd79a4c
confirmations
52786
spent
true